    OpenEars 2.506, iPhone 5s, speaking into built-in mic from 8..10 inch distance, using grammar mode with vocabulary:

    @{OneOfTheseWillBeSaidOnce:@[@”HELLO ROBOT”,
    @”HEY THERE”,
    @”GREEN CROCODILE”,
    @”HELLO PEOPLE”,
    @”HEY YOU NERD”,
    @”EMERGENCY SITUATION”]}

    when saying, “I didn’t say that” I get “HEY THERE”. Often when I pronounce “Hello People” I get “HEY THERE”. I understand that these sound similar. Is there a way to get the probability for detection so I can filter out hypotheses with low credibility? Or is probability unavailable in JSGF mode?
